Default getting my swingarm off??

anyone have any ideas for getting the swingarm off an 01 f4i?? i have everything taken loose from it and the bolt out of the swingarm. i bumped it and the left side has come out and the right side is binding up for some reason. anyone know what i should do?

The swing arm needs to come straight off out the back. If one side has come out, then it's most likely causing the other side to bind. See if you can get the left side back in, and even the pivot bolt back in. Then, remove the pivot bolt and pull the swing arm straight out.

i figured out the problem. i have to take the swingarm castle nuts out first. this is my first time taking my swingarm off so sorta new to that aspect. ordered the castle nut socket last night though.
